  • Real Monge-Ampere equations and Kahler-Ricci solitons on toric log Fano varieties
  • 2013
  • In: Annales de la faculté des sciences de Toulouse. - : Cellule MathDoc/CEDRAM. - 0240-2963 .- 2258-7519. ; 22:4, s. 649-711
  • Journal article (peer-reviewed)abstract
    • We show, using a direct variational approach, that the second boundary value problem for the Monge-Ampère equation in $\mathbb{R}^{n}$ with exponential non-linearity and target a convex body $P$ is solvable iff $0$ is the barycenter of $P.$ Combined with some toric geometry this confirms, in particular, the (generalized) Yau-Tian-Donaldson conjecture for toric log Fano varieties $(X,\Delta )$ saying that $(X,\Delta )$ admits a (singular) Kähler-Einstein metric iff it is K-stable in the algebro-geometric sense. We thus obtain a new proof and extend to the log Fano setting the seminal result of Wang-Zhou concerning the case when $X$ is smooth and $\Delta $ is trivial. Li’s toric formula for the greatest lower bound on the Ricci curvature is also generalized. More generally, we obtain Kähler-Ricci solitons on any log Fano variety and show that they appear as the large time limit of the Kähler-Ricci flow. Furthermore, using duality, we also confirm a conjecture of Donaldson concerning solutions to Abreu’s boundary value problem on the convex body $P$ in the case of a given canonical measure on the boundary of $P.$

  • An elementary proof of the Briancon-Skoda theorem
  • 2010
  • In: Ann. fac. sci. Toulouse. - : Cellule MathDoc/CEDRAM. - 0240-2963. ; Ser. 6, Vol. 19:3-4
  • Journal article (peer-reviewed)abstract
    • We give an elementary proof of the Briancon-Skoda theorem. The theorem gives a criterion for when a function \phi belongs to an ideal I of the ring of germs of analytic functions at 0 \in ℂ^n; more precisely, the ideal membership is obtained if a function associated with \phi and I is locally square integrable. If I can be generated by m elements, it follows in particular that the integral closure of I^min(m,n) is contained in I.

  • Minkowski sums and Brownian exit times
  • 2007
  • In: ANNALES DE LA FACULTE DES SCIENCES DE TOULOUSE Mathematiques. - 0240-2963. ; XVI:1, s. 37-47
  • Journal article (peer-reviewed)abstract
    • If C is a domain in R^n, the Brownian exit time of C is denoted by T^C. Given domains C and D in R^n this paper gives an upper bound of the distribution function of T^(C+D) when the distribution functions of T^C and T^D are known. The bound is sharp if C and D are parallel affine half-spaces. The paper also exhibits an extension of the Ehrhard inequality.

  • Analytic continuation of fundamental solutions to differential equations with constant coefficients
  • 2011
  • In: Annales de la Faculté des Sciences de Toulouse, Mathématiques. - Toulouse : Université Paul Sabatier. - 0240-2963. ; (6) 20:S2, s. 153-182
  • Journal article (peer-reviewed)abstract
    • If $P$ is a polynomial in ${\bf R}^n$ such that $1/P$ integrable, then the inverse Fourier transform of $1/P$ is a fundamental solution $E_P$ to the differential operator $P(D)$. The purpose of the article is to study the dependence of this fundamental solution on the polynomial $P$. For $n=1$ it is shown that $E_P$ can be analytically continued to a Riemann space over the set of all polynomials of the same degree as $P$. The singularities of this extension are studied.

  • On a representation of the fundamental class of an ideal due to Lejeune-Jalabert
  • 2016
  • In: Annales de la Faculté des Sciences de Toulouse. - 2258-7519. ; 25:5, s. 1051-1078
  • Journal article (peer-reviewed)abstract
    • Lejeune-Jalabert showed that the fundamental class of a Cohen-Macaulay ideal $\a\subset \Ok_0$ admits a representation as a residue, constructed from a free resolution of $\a$, multiplied by a certain differential form coming from the resolution. We give an explicit description of this differential form in the case when the free resolution is the Scarf resolution of a generic monomial ideal. As a consequence we get a new proof and a refinement of Lejeune-Jalabert's result in this case.
